Hordhac Modules Thyristor Diode

Qaybaha Thyristor diode, Inta badan si fudud loogu yeero thyristors, waa nooc ka mid ah aaladda semiconductor ee ugu horrayn loo isticmaalo xakamaynta iyo beddelka awoodda korantada ee codsiyada kala duwan. Waxay u dhaqmaan sidii shixnad la xakameeyey, u oggolaanshaha hadda inuu qulqulo marka uu kiciyo calaamada albaabka yar. Mar la shiday, way sii soconayaan ilaa inta hadda la marayo ay ka hoos marayso heer cayiman ama jihada hadda loo rogo.

Qaybta thyristor waxay caadi ahaan ka kooban tahay thyristors badan oo la isku duba riday si ay u xakameeyaan qulqulka sare ama danab ka badan hal qayb oo maamuli kara. Qaybahaan waxaa laga heli karaa qaabab kala duwan, oo ay ku jiraan SCR (Dib-u-habeeya Silikoonka oo La Xakameeyo), TRIAC, iyo GTO (Daminta Albaabka) thyristors, mid kasta oo loogu talagalay noocyada gaarka ah ee hawlaha xakamaynta awoodda.

Specification of DPSS not laser diode module 532nm 545nm 555nm 561nm 571nm

DPSS laser modules supply exact and reliable efficiency for applications requiring details noticeable wavelengths. These modules use diode-pumped solid-state innovation to produce laser light at 532nm, 545nm, 555nm, 561nm, and 571nm. Each wavelength serves different objectives. The 532nm (green) prevails in fluorescence microscopy and laser shows. The 545nm and 555nm (green-yellow) suit biomedical imaging and circulation cytometry. The 561nm (yellow-green) works well in DNA sequencing and Raman spectroscopy. The 571nm (yellow) is optimal for assessment and holography.

Applications of DPSS not laser diode module 532nm 545nm 555nm 561nm 571nm

DPSS (Diode-Pumped Solid-State) laser components provide specific wavelengths like 532nm, 545nm, 555nm, 561nm, and 571nm. These are not standard laser diodes. They offer specialized duties across industries. The 532nm green laser is extensively utilized in biomedical imaging. It thrills fluorescent dyes in microscopy. It helps visualize cellular structures clearly. This wavelength is additionally typical in laser light programs. It creates intense green beam of lights target markets see easily.

The 545nm and 555nm wavelengths fall in the green-yellow range. They are ideal for clinical applications. Dermatology uses them for vascular treatments. They target capillary without destructive surrounding cells. These wavelengths work in circulation cytometry also. They assist analyze cell residential properties in research study.

The 561nm laser is essential in fluorescence microscopy. It couple with yellow fluorescent healthy proteins. This boosts image resolution in live-cell research studies. It is additionally used in Raman spectroscopy. It determines molecular frameworks in materials science.

The 571nm yellow laser suits ophthalmology. It treats retinal conditions with high accuracy. It decreases dangers to healthy eye cells. Industrial uses consist of positioning devices. Factories use it for calibration in manufacturing. It guarantees precision in setting up procedures.

5 FAQs of DPSS not laser diode module 532nm 545nm 555nm 561nm 571nm

What is a DPSS module?
A DPSS module is a type of laser system. It uses a diode-pumped solid-state design. This design differs from standard laser diode modules. It generates light through crystals and other components. The process creates precise wavelengths like 532nm, 545nm, 555nm, 561nm, or 571nm. These modules are compact and efficient. They are ideal for applications needing stable output.

Why are these specific wavelengths offered?
The wavelengths 532nm, 545nm, 555nm, 561nm, and 571nm are chosen for their utility. They match the absorption peaks of common materials. Examples include fluorescent dyes or sensors. These wavelengths are popular in research, caafimaad, and industrial fields. They enable tasks like fluorescence imaging or particle detection. Their availability supports diverse technical needs.

What applications suit these DPSS modules?
These modules work in fields requiring precise green-yellow light. They are used in bioimaging, flow cytometry, or holography. Industrial uses include alignment or quality control. Medical applications might involve dermatology or diagnostics. The wavelengths ensure compatibility with equipment. They deliver reliability in sensitive processes.

Are these lasers safe to use?
DPSS modules emit high-intensity light. Safety depends on proper handling. Most units are Class 3B or higher. Protective eyewear is necessary. Follow guidelines for laser operation. Avoid direct exposure to skin or eyes. Install safety interlocks where required. User training reduces risks.

How long do these modules last?
Typical lifespans exceed 10,000 saacadood. Durability depends on operating conditions. Maintain stable temperatures. Avoid excessive power surges. Regular cleaning prevents dust buildup. Proper storage extends functionality. Component wear varies with usage intensity. Most users report years of consistent performance.
